The Ferrari 488 GTB may be turbocharged, but its 3.9-liter V8 still screams all the way up to 8000 rpm. And with 661 horsepower on tap, it'll launch to 60 mph in three seconds flat and do the quarter mile in 10.5 seconds. Keep your foot down, and the 488 will keep pulling all the way up to 205 mph.

Needless to say, the 488 GTB is already a ridiculously quick car. Like the 458 Challenge that came before it, the next logical step is for Ferrari to turn it into a race car for its Challenge series. And from what we can tell, that's exactly what you see testing in the video below.

The humongous wing is a new addition, and the car's front end appears to have a much more aggressive aero package. And while it doesn't sound quite as good as the old naturally aspirated 458 Challenge, it still sounds fantastic, but it might be a bit too quiet.

Considering how complete this test car looks, we suspect Ferrari won't make us wait much longer for the official reveal.
